Failure to Follow Enhanced Barrier Precautions and Hand Hygiene During Wound Care
D
F0880 F880: Provide and implement an infection prevention and control program.
Short Summary

Staff failed to follow Enhanced Barrier Precautions and proper hand hygiene during wound care for two residents with pressure ulcers. In both cases, staff either did not change gloves or perform hand hygiene between wound cleansing and treatment, or did not wear required gowns despite posted signage and available PPE. Interviews confirmed that staff were trained and aware of the correct procedures, but did not adhere to facility policy or CDC guidelines during the observed wound care activities.
